Transaction 0810357221590fa9a9eba183c79a9c2d9359d0288e45451fe18c311cf72a7724

1 Input
2 Outputs
  • 0810357221590fa9a9eba183c79a9c2d9359d0288e45451fe18c311cf72a7724:0
  • value  28258
    address  39txX77oYk6iTudPnBEY1kzz3BWxB6Z7G7
  • 0810357221590fa9a9eba183c79a9c2d9359d0288e45451fe18c311cf72a7724:1
  • value  2222878
    address  bc1q6j3hcfv5nr5tpmajhjcjhgfjz56aecn2g0ynw6